Apache Struts 1.2.7 - Error Response Cross-Site Scripting

text exploit Source: Exploit-DB
source: https://www.securityfocus.com/bid/15512/info

Struts is prone to a cross-site scripting vulnerability because the application fails to properly sanitize user-supplied input.

An attacker may leverage this issue to have arbitrary script code execute in the browser of an unsuspecting user in the context of the affected site. This may help the attacker steal cookie-based authentication credentials and launch other attacks. 

http://www.example.com/struts-virtdir/<script>alert('test')</script>.do
